  2. The crew cabin and the cargo tail are indeed buggy, they don't shield anything, and it breaks any cargo bays connected to them too. However, if you put a drone core or service bay between the buggy part and the rest of your cargo bay, everything will be shielded!

  11. Spaceplanes don't reduce the delta-v requirements, they actually increase them a lot for a normal spaceplane ascent because you stay in the atmosphere a lot longer, causing lots of drag losses. The reason spaceplanes are efficient is because they normally use jet engines to gain a lot of their speed, and jet engines are a LOT more fuel efficient than rocket engines.
